Total control: Interview with Qatar Airways' Akbar Al Baker

 

(...) The anticipated growth in traffic at Qatar Airways over the coming few years is such that the green light has already been given for the second phase of the new airport. Phase one will produce an airport with a capacity of 12 million passengers a year. “By 2010 Qatar Airways itself will carry 12 million passengers,” explains Al Baker. Phase two of the construction work will see an airport with twice this capacity.

 

During 2006 the carrier expects to plug at least one of the glaring gaps in its network – the USA. When its takes delivery of its first of two long-range Airbus A340-600s it will begin serving New York’s JFK International Airport, says Al Baker. “The timing depends on the aircraft delivery – we are being told September and October by Airbus.” At present it does not serve any destinations in Australasia either. This will most probably be remedied later in 2006 or perhaps in 2007 depending on the outcome of discussions between the Qatari and Australian governments.

 

When it comes to new aircraft orders, Qatar is an increasingly influential player. It is the lead A350 customer for Airbus with a letter of intent to buy 60 of the mid-sized widebody for delivery from 2010. Al Baker wants to go ahead and sign a firm order, but Airbus is not quite ready yet. “We have not signed the purchase agreement with Airbus because they have not crystallized the specification of the airplane and also we have requirements for the performance which they have to come back to us with,” he says. “The aircraft is still changing, but we expect Airbus to come up with the solution soon.” (...)
